Some Assembly Required

Shortly after Valentines Day, I received a dollhouse kit in the mail.  Much to the surprise of my husband, I hadn't ordered it for myself (even though I had been coveting it for quite some time).  It was a gift from my mother.  I found myself both ecstatic and slightly overwhelmed.

I had received the Beachside Bungalow Dollhouse Kit created by Real Good Toys.  I opened the box immediately and found lots of parts and pieces.  Then the box rested and lie dormant for many weeks (okay, perhaps several months).

If you follow along you'll read about my adventures in wabi sabi dollhouse building   Wabi sabi was a phrase I was introduced to while my mother was exploring fung shei and I was re-learning how to use a sewing machine about dozen years ago.  In short wabi sabi means an acceptance of life's imperfections.  The term fit every sewing project that I completed.  I am certain my dollhouse will not let the wabi sabi fan club down either.
